The Green Tortoise Hostel has been a favorite of backpackers and
travellers for decades. From our unbeatable location in
historic North Beach (a quick walk to tourist favorites like Chinatown
and Fisherman's Wharf), to our cozy dorm rooms, to our relaxing private
rooms with free movies, to our free meals and pub crawls, to our famous
Adventure Travel bus tours...those are just a few of the reasons the
Tortoise has become a legend.
